Nwlapcug.com


Come ottenere IE per supportare CSS3

Cascading Style Sheets (CSS) controllo l'aspetto dei siti Web e CSS3 è la specifica più recente per i CSS. Mentre CSS3 aggiunge funzionalità quali sfumature, ombre e angoli arrotondati, le versioni di Internet Explorer (IE) 6 a 8 non supportano affatto CSS3. Aggiunta di un file di poli-riempimento - un file HTC che "riempie" il supporto IE è manca - al tuo sito Web vi permetterà di utilizzare alcune proprietà CSS3 base. Di CSS3 pochi poli-riempimenti che esistono, uno dei migliori da utilizzare per l'aggiunta di effetti visivi è CSS3 PIE (Progressive Internet Explorer).

Istruzioni

1

Vai a css3pie e scaricare CSS3 PIE, uno script di poli-materiale di riempimento che aggiunge supporto CSS3 limitato per il tuo sito quando visitatori caricarlo in Internet Explorer versioni 6 a 8. Decomprimere il CSS3 PIE sul computer e caricarlo sul server Web, se il tuo sito è già online.

2

Aprire il file CSS associato con il tuo sito Web. Selettori CSS, ad esempio "#mydiv" o "tagname," insieme con le coppie di valori di proprietà contenute tra le parentesi graffe, costituiscono le regole di stile. Aggiungere questo codice a ogni regola di stile che contiene le proprietà CSS3:

comportamento: URL(path/to/PIE.htc);

Cambiamento "path/to/PIE.htc" il percorso del file PIE.htc.

3

Individuare qualsiasi sfumatura lineare nel file CSS e scrivere una nuova coppia di valori di proprietà:

-torta-sfondo: lineare-gradient(top, #ffffff, #000000);

La coppia di cui sopra non sostituisce altri nel codice. Si tratta di un paio che aggiunge il supporto per CSS3 PIE solo. Non utilizzare "sfondo - torta--immagine." Modificare i valori per la sfumatura, come direzione o colori, per abbinare la sfumatura che si desidera utilizzare.

4

Modificare qualsiasi codice di colore RGBa (rosso, verde, blu e alfa) nel CSS3 in esadecimale. Il CSS3 PIE poli-riempimento può utilizzare i valori di colore RGBa ma non renderà i colori con qualsiasi trasparenza. Lasciare un valore RGBa da solo se quel colore non sarà male quando reso opaco.

Consigli & Avvertenze

  • Si possono ottenere molti effetti di CSS3 utilizzando JavaScript fallback. Questi fallback aggiungere spesso soltanto un effetto alla volta, però.
  • È consigliabile consentire il tuo sito Web a degradare con garbo in browser meno recenti. Ciò significa che anche se alcuni utenti non vedranno gli angoli arrotondati o sfumature, possono ancora leggere e utilizzare il sito Web.
  • CSS3 PIE funziona meglio con siti Web HTML normale, "statico". Quando applicato a modelli o temi per dynamic Content Management Systems (CMS), il file di poli-materiale di riempimento non sempre funziona, o potrebbe comportarsi in modo strano.
  • Questa tecnica non aggiungerà lo shadowing di testo di supporto per il tuo sito. Si dovrebbe verificare che il colore del tuo testo non interferisce con la leggibilità quando l'ombra è manca.